Most folks here will tell you that you shouldn't run a 4 or 5-point system until you get a rollbar. Otherwise, in a rollover, the harness will insure that your head is the first thing the collapsing roof hits.

In any case, the shoulder harness mounting points should be level with or just slightly (15 deg?)below the level of where they go over your shoulders, and as close to the seat as possible. Not really any good places to do that in a rex without a rollbar with harness bar included.

DO NOT mount them on the floor behind the seat. In a collision, tension on the shoulder belts will cause them to pull your shoulders down, compressing your spine. This is not good.

understood about the roll bar, and not mounting them on the floor directly behind the seats (spine compression)


I have seen harnesses wrapped around Beefy rear strut tower bars.

Any other place to mount they eye bolts is right above the gas tank. So I was looking for some insite.

ive seen them bolted to the strut mounts. a bit offset, but as long as the belts are long enough, itll fit fine. the big problem i see with that is that its a bit long of a distance, and because belts are made to stretch, perhaps it allows too much stretch during impact...
